After injected inter-muscularly into upper back, traps and neck area, I immediately felt a numb sensation on face lips inside mouth back of throat and dizziness to the point where I was certain I was going to faint. Days, into 2nd week there was still pain at injection sites, tiredness, fatigue, nausea and a constant sore throat. At end of 2nd week after injections, I woke up with a 'mysterious' hive-like rash on my back, abdomen and arms, while asleep one night, that I had never experienced before. My doctor had me take Zyrtec and and cortisone cream on the itchy rash. The day it cleared, I experienced bleeding from my ear, pounding in ear and head. Another thing never experienced before. Others have said he tolerate it well or have lesser side effects than me. I will NEVER allow that to be injected into me again.

November 25, 2007 - I am a 42 year old woman, tall very thin, and always in good health. I was prescribed Singular for mild asthma symptoms, ie.. asthmatic cough-very mild, heavy feeling in the chest, constant sore throat (my work requires me to use my voice a lot). Initally my symptoms improved, I was thrilled! But, after about a month I got up one morning and thought I was having a stroke - my head was killing me, and my heart was pounding so hard! I took my blood pressure only to find that my normally low pressure was now 144/105! My pulse ws nearly 100 beats/min. That's just while I was sleeping! I was shocked! The only meds I was on was the Singular. I decided to do a little experiment on myself. I immediately stopped taking the Singular and kept a record of my blood pressure. It took about 3 days for my blood pressure to come back down to normal levels. I have noticed some weight gain as well. I will not take this drug again!

I was started on Advair HFA about 35 days ago. A little background about me is that I'm 35 years old, in good physical shape. I'm a competitive cyclists doing road races anywhere from 45-100 miles, I work out 2-4 hours everyday. I've had lifelong chronic asthma, but have fought the disease with my healthy lifestyle. I also play the saxophone.
Since I've been on Advair I've developed a constant sore throat. Been coughing up stuff constantly when I'm out training on my bike. Can't seem to sleep for more than a few hours at a time. The worst side affect has been the leg cramps which are killing my training for up coming races. I have constant leg cramps that force me to get out of bed over and over to work them out. My energy levels have dropped to the point that I can't do even half a workout without being totally wiped out. This is coming from a guy that averages 60miles a day on the bike, the other day I couldn't even do 15 miles and had to stop from the constant cramps and tiredness. This stuff is a nightmare. I've gone back to using nothing but my albuterol inhaler. I'll continue to do lung exercises 4 times a day and completely clean up my diet and basically get this stuff out of my system.
